K Job Summary:
Our client an exciting opportunity for a Power Platform Developer supporting the Test Operations and Sustainment contract at Arnold Air Force Base, TN. The person selected for this role will work closely with multidisciplinary work teams throughout the client organization to leverage Microsoft Power Platform tools to deliver solutions that improve operational efficiency, enhance data visibility, and support mission critical decision making. Key Responsibilities Design, develop, and deploy custom applications using Microsoft Power Apps, including both canvas and model-driven apps, to automate and improve business processes across multiple organizations at Arnold AFB.
  • Build interactive dashboards and reports in PowerBI to provide actionable insights into operational performance, maintenance metrics, and organization KPIs
  • Create and manage automated workflows using Power Automate to eliminate manual processes, improve data accuracy, and increase organizational efficiency
  • Configure and manage Dataverse environments, including data modeling, security roles, and entity relationships to support application development
  • Collaborate with stakeholders across the mission areas to gather requirements, define user stories, and deliver solutions that meet mission needs
  • Integrate Power Platform solutions with existing enterprise systems, SQL Server, SharePoint, Microsoft 365, and other data sources as required.
  • Develop and maintain technical documentation, user guides, and training materials for developed applications and dashboards
  • Provide ongoing support, troubleshooting, and continuous improvement for deployed solutions
  • Follow established development standards, change management processes, and cybersecurity requirements as applicable to DoW environments
  • It is a condition of employment to wear company issued PPE (Personal Protective Equipment) in accordance with supervisory direction and company policy.
  • Performs other related duties as required.
Basic Qualifications:
  • Current and active Secret clearance required
  • BS in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, Management Information Systems, or another relevant technical field from an accredited college or university
  • Minimum 3 (three) years' experience developing solutions on the Microsoft Power Platform (PowerBI, Power Automate, PowerApps, Dataverse)
  • Proficiency creating PowerBI reports and dashboards, including DAX formulas, data modeling, and data transformations Preferred Qualifications
  • Demonstrated experience developing PowerApps with SQL Server or Dataverse as the backend data store
  • Working knowledge of SharePoint Online, Microsoft 365
  • Microsoft certification in Power Platform products (PL-100,
  • 200,
  • 300, and/or
  • 400).
  • Familiarity with Azure services such as Azure SQL especially as they relate to extending Power Platform capabilities
  • Knowledge of REST APIs and experience integrating third party systems with Power Platform using custom connectors
  • Experience with JavaScript, Typescript, or C# for developing custom connectors, plug-ins, or PowerApps Component Framework controls.
